Transaction 38e3d889cf2fc740853afbebdaf7e2b483f848a18aaad14e63f467de0d40ff06
1 Input
1 Output
-
38e3d889cf2fc740853afbebdaf7e2b483f848a18aaad14e63f467de0d40ff06:0
- value
- 22000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57f18c6cfbc74080010b8155174f55e4ed2fe992 OP_EQUAL
- address
- 39i25KVYCCEQGRtJFWiEfzvvZU6dXVnth9